Welcome To The Grant Smith Physio Therapy Centre
At our centre in Westby Street, Lytham our team of professionals provide a wide range of therapies designed to treat a number of acute and chronic physical conditions afflicting persons in every age group.
My name is Mark Smith and it is my privilege to manage this family-run business founded by my father some 50 years ago. Here under one roof can be found a multi-disciplined and varied spectrum of services including:
Physiotherapy- Massage Therapy
- Aromatherapy
- Acupuncture
- Podiatry
- Aqua Therapy
- Hypnotherapy
- Complementary Therapies
- Herbal Medicine
- Tai Chi And Qigong
- Sports Medicine
- Nutrition
At the outset each patient is offered an initial assessment as a means to determine an accurate diagnosis of the problem. Then, in the skilled hands of our practitioners, therapies are tailored to relieve and ameliorate acute conditions, including sports injuries, and those of a chronic nature which will require ongoing, long-term treatment.
We serve a clientele which includes residents of Lytham itself, but with a coverage that extends up the Fylde coast to include St Anne’s, Blackpool and eastwards into the villages of Warton and Freckleton. There is ample provision for access to the centre for patients in wheelchairs or who have a particular issue with mobility. Nevertheless, we are always happy to carry out home visits for those who find it particularly difficult or impractical to come to the centre.
All our practitioners are registered with the Health Professions Council and the centre is open most weekdays between 9.00am and 8.00pm and on Saturday mornings between 9.00am and 1.00pm.
